Planning application
133, High Street, Barkingside, Ilford, IG6 2AJ
Works: Roofing
Refused. Only the applicant can appeal, within the statutory time limit, and a revised scheme can be submitted instead.
Proposal
Change of use of ground and first floor from Bank (Class E) to mixed use Sui Generis, including Recreational facility (E(d)), including Community Meeting/Training use (F2(b)) and as an Ancillary Place of Worship (F1(f)). Proposed hours of operation: Monday – Friday 06:00 – 23:00 and Saturday – Sunday 09:00 – 23:00. Installation of Green Roof and new railings to rear ground floor roof. Alterations to fenestrations. About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
